The Anchorage market

Why the contractor who ranks in Anchorage wins the work

Picture the homeowner at the other end of the search. It is January, the thermostat reads -25°F, the furnace just died, and a family in Spenard or South Anchorage has maybe a few hours before pipes start freezing. They are not reading three quotes. They tap the first contractor Google puts in front of them and they call right now. That is the Anchorage market in one sentence, and two forces make it relentless. First, the climate never lets up: a six-month heating season, burst pipes, snow-loaded roofs, and the seismic risk that the 2018 quake made impossible to ignore mean the phone has a reason to ring in almost every month of the year. Second, Joint Base Elmendorf-Richardson rotates thousands of military families through Anchorage on PCS orders, and a household that landed three weeks ago has no neighbor to ask and no contractor on speed dial; they search, and they hire whoever shows up first. If your competitor owns that moment and you do not, the quality of your crew never even enters the conversation. You want to be the name they find before they think to look for a second one.
